Lewis "Lew" Dauber (April 27, 1949 â€" October 3, 2019) was an

American character actor. He was best known for his frequent casting

as a clergyman, appearing as such in various productions over more

than two decades.Although born in New York City, Dauber earned his

bachelor's degree in California from the University of California,

Berkeley, where he performed as building inspector Henri Cotte (Henri

Paillardin in the original), in the school's 1969 production of Hotel

Paradiso. After graduation, he became an employee of Citibank, where

he sold traveler's checks, though he soon quit to pursue a career in

show business. While he managed to land some small commercial parts,

it was his appearance on a second-season episode of The Fall Guy,

alongside Lee Majors and Tony Curtis, that earned him his first

credited acting role.Despite having steady work most of his career,

Dauber found time to return to school later in life, earning his

master's degree at Mount St. Mary's University. Following his

graduation, he would return to teach in the University's department of

film, media and social justice. Additionally, he served on the

SAG-AFTRA credit union board of directors.On May 25, 1986, Dauber

married Paulette Levin, a publicist for the Walt Disney Company whose

credits also include Dodgeball: A True Underdog Story, Rent,

Unaccompanied Minors and Mars Needs Moms.[better source needed]

Together, the couple had two sons, Jeff and Zach.
